The majority of sleeper sofas require assembly before you can enjoy the benefits, but it is typically a simple procedure that takes between 10 to 15 minutes. Make sure to take measurements of your space and the dimensions of the box it is delivered in to ensure that the sofa will fit into your home prior to buying. You may need to measure your front entrance, hallways and tight corners to make sure the furniture can pass through. If you live in a condominium or apartment, you should also determine if the sofa can fit in the elevator or stairwell in your building.

If you're considering a convertible sectional be aware that certain models come with an integrated bed that is easier to be converted than others. Certain styles require you to take off the cushions on the sofa to reveal the sleeping surface, while others have a unique mechanism that can operate at the click. Some sleeper sectionals have the standard size mattress, while others don't, which can make it difficult to find sheets that work with the beds.
